View of Oxford from above Ferry Hinksey

View of Oxford from above Ferry Hinksey is an oil painting by the Impressionist artist Joseph Fisher. It is held in the collection of the Ashmolean Museum.

Subject & Meaning
The painting depicts a landscape view of Oxford from above Ferry Hinksey, featuring trees and fields in the foreground and buildings in the distance under a cloudy grey sky.
Technique & Style
The artist's use of light filtering through trees, casting dappled shadows, adds depth and texture to the scene, characteristic of Fisher's landscape style.
